(Left side of journal)

CASH ACCOUNT. NOVEMBER.

Date. Received. Paid
2d Eliza & Jas. Hill Received $1.00
3d Horse feed Paid $1.00
10th Dora Received .50
10th J.T. Henderson for flour Paid .50
18th Mrs F Corregan Received $10.00
19th Daul Green & Co. Shoes Paid $2.50
19th Money order & postage Paid .7
19th Gilbert T. Smith Received .50
19th Flour Paid .50
19th Groceries & c Paid .74
19th Cork for horse Paid .25
19th Mustard & tobacco Paid .10
21st Soap, horse shoes & c Paid .17
21st Money order & postage (vaccine) Paid $1.07
21st Oatmeal Paid .8
22d Milk Paid .5
23d Kate Stabler Received $3.50
23d Corn meal Paid .15
23d Bringing coal from M. Gilpin Paid .25
23d Coal oil & sundries Paid .15
24th Corn & screenings Paid .35
24th Ed. Easton (sawing wood) Paid .25
25th Milk Paid .5
25th Coffee & tobacco Paid .17
25th Ton No. 3 Coal Paid $5.00
25th Toll Paid .10

(Right side of journal)

CASH ACCOUNT. NOVEMBER

Date. Received. Paid
25th Paid "John" Paid .75
25th Sausage (6 lbs) Paid .60
28th Corn for horse Paid .25
28th Tobacco Paid .5
28th Coal oil Paid .10
28th Tea Paid .16
28th Writing tablet Paid .10
28th Postal card Paid .1
29th Postage Paid .4
